let Arr=[{name:"小小"},{name:"大大"},{name:"重重"},{name:"小小"},{name:"大大"}];
//调用
unique(Arr);
function unique(Arr) {
var hash = {};
Arr = Arr.reduce(function(arr, current) {
hash[current.name]
? ""
: (hash[current.name] = true && arr.push(current));
return arr;
}, []);
return Arr;
}
注返回:Arr=[{name:"小小"},{name:"大大"},{name:"重重"}]